Cheese Stuffed Chikuwa Fritters with Shiso

  1. Slit open the chikuwa.
  2. Cut the sliced cheese in half and stack it together.
  3. Spread out the chikuwa, and place the shiso leaf and cheese inside.
  4. Roll it up from the end.
  5. Secure it with a toothpick.
  6. Make the rest in the same manner.
  7. If you are using thick cheese, then you should wrap it to 1 cm thickness.
  8. Mix the katakuriko and yukari together in a bowl (yukari is optional).
  9. Coat the chikuwa from step 6 in the flour from step 7, then knock off excess flour.
  10. Stick a pair of cooking chopsticks into a pot of hot oil, and wait until it starts to bubble.
  11. After heating the oil, fry over high heat for about 20 seconds.
  12. (Until the color of the chikuwa darkens a bit).
  13. Drain off the oil.
